Why Dental X-Rays Are Essential for a Healthy Smile

When you look in the mirror, your teeth might seem perfectly fine—but what’s happening beneath the surface? 🦷 Many dental issues start silently, without pain or visible signs, making it easy to think everything is okay. That’s where dental X-rays come in.

 

These powerful diagnostic tools give your dentist a behind-the-scenes look at your oral health, catching problems early before they turn into major concerns.

 

What Can Dental X-Rays Reveal?

  • Hidden Cavities – Decay can develop between teeth or under fillings, long before you feel any discomfort.

  • Infections Beneath the Gums – An X-ray can spot infections or abscesses that could lead to serious complications if left untreated.

  • Bone Loss – Gum disease can weaken the bone that supports your teeth, and X-rays help detect early signs of deterioration.

  • Impacted Wisdom Teeth – Wisdom teeth sometimes grow in the wrong direction, leading to pain, crowding, or even infection. X-rays help your dentist plan the best course of action.

 

Without regular dental X-rays, you could be missing problems that aren’t yet visible or painful. Early detection means easier, less expensive treatments—while waiting too long could lead to more complex procedures like root canals or extractions.
